It looks as though Ubisoft isn't quite done with Scott Pilgrim. The company has been threatening to release a new batch of DLC for the 2010 game for some time now, and it could be inching forward. Again.
Major Nelson has posted a February 6 release date for the add-on, which includes a playable Wallace Wells character and online multiplayer. It's listed at 160 Microsoft Points ($2). It's not the first time he's posted a release date for the DLC, however.
The last time we'd heard anything about this was a fleeting rumor that the content, was canceled. The comic's creator, Bryan O'Malley, squashed it.
